Top Master Naturalist Program | Reviews & Ratings | vimarsana.com

Master naturalist program in United states - 32926 / Organization near Brevard

Master naturalist program in United states - 36849 / School near Lee

Master naturalist program in United states - 32611 / Education near Alachua

Master naturalist program in United states - 56265 / Education near Chippewa